The LAND ROVER DEFENDER (2011-15) is a rugged and iconic SUV that is widely recognised in the UK for its durability and distinctive design. It is part of the well-known Land Rover family and is popular among those who require a tough, capable vehicle for off-road adventures, countryside work, or those seeking a dependable vehicle for challenging terrains. With over 13,500 lookups on mycarcheck.com and nearly 6,000 different VINs checked, it is clear that this model remains a sought-after choice for used car buyers. Typically, the LAND ROVER DEFENDER (2011-15) appeals to outdoor enthusiasts, farmers, and professionals who need a reliable vehicle with high off-road capability. Despite its utilitarian roots, it attracts those wanting a vehicle that offers a blend of heritage, robustness, and a unique presence on the road. The average private sale valuation of £32,500 and a typical mileage of around 52,000 miles suggest that it’s a durable vehicle, often well-maintained. What makes the Defender stand out is its legendary build quality and reputation for longevity, often surpassing rivals in the same class. Known for its straightforward, no-nonsense design and excellent off-road performance, it’s less suited for city driving but excels in demanding conditions. The Defender is a best choice for those valuing practicality and a rugged aesthetic over urban comfort.
